>> one way is to use space button repeatedly;but is there any other way to
>> achieve this?
>> regards,
>>
>>  Try using FORMAT>>COLUMNS then select on many on the dialogue box.
>
> If you are trying to have variable indent you can set the tab stops on the
> ruler (View>>Ruler) to where you want them. Then you can tab over.
>
> Another possibility is to use a table without showing any borders.
